POS Restaurant Kitchen Printer

While Kitchen Display Systems (KDS) are highly effective for streamlining kitchen operations, a kitchen printer can still be an essential tool for certain tasks. It provides tangible order receipts for takeout orders, helps with packing instructions, and ensures accurate labeling or tracking of orders. The physical printout can be particularly useful in fast-paced environments where visual or tangible confirmations are needed. Integrating both KDS and a kitchen printer can offer flexibility and accommodate varying needs effectively.

Optimizing Restaurant Workflow: Single vs. Multi-Printer Setups

The choice between single or multi-printer setups often depends on the restaurant's scale, menu complexity, and volume of orders

Single Printer Setup

Single Printer Setup

  • Suitable for smaller restaurants with less complex operations.
  • All orders, whether for dine-in, takeout, or delivery, are printed on a single printer.
  • Centralizes order management but can create bottlenecks during peak hours if the printer is overused.
Multiple Printer Setup

Multiple Printer Setup

  • Ideal for larger restaurants with multiple stations or specialized areas (e.g., bar, dessert station, takeout).
  • Orders are routed to specific printers based on the type of order or section of the kitchen. For example:
    • Kitchen Printer: Prints orders for food preparation.
    • Bar Printer: Prints drink orders for the bar staff.
    • Packing Printer: Prints labels or receipts for takeout and delivery packaging.
  • Enhances workflow efficiency, reduces confusion, and minimizes delays during high-volume periods.
